The Rt is bone stock with only 2500 miles. Been messing with it the last couple weeks. It had a shake at speed. I adjusted the toe in some. It was set up dead straight when I started. That took some of it out, but still didn't feel right. So I took the front wheels to my tire guy and had them spin balanced. One didn't have any weights on from the factory and took 1.75 ounces to get it balanced. Wow what a difference that made. Very smooth now. Might look into a belt idler yet. Sure seems like they should have come from the factory with one.
